Research

Dynamics of disordered materials (including low-energy excitation spectra, low-temperature properties, implications for other properties, etc.);

Glass transition; Raman, Brillouin and neutron scattering spectroscopies of disordered materials (including glasses, polymers, liquids and disordered crystals);

Dynamics and functions of biological macromolecules; Photonics and nano-optics, scanning nano-Raman spectroscopy.
